Did you pick your doctor, or did the employer and insurance pick the doctor?
Nothing is more important than a good doctor. Many times an employer won't even send employees for treatment. However, you have the right to see a doctor of your choice.
You should see a doctor that is not working for the insurance company. Insurance companies keep contracts with industrial clinics, like Concentra and Work Partners, where doctors are under pressure and controlled by insurance companies. Those doctors are pressured to send injured workers back to work whether they can work or not.
We will find a doctor that cares about you more than keeping insurance companies happy. It's important to know how to get a judge to order the insurance to provide authorization to see a doctor of your choice, without authorization the doctors won't see you. We will get the authorization and get you to a better doctor.
Insurance will also seek to have a doctor discharge an injured worker before all treatment has been provided and/or seek to have workers discharged without a proper report providing workers with compensation.
It is important to get a good report. Reports are evidence, and judges need evidence. Insurance companies know how to get their evidence ready, and how to prevent you from getting your best evidence.
We know which doctors provide good reports and what makes a good report. We know how to get a judge to order the insurance company to pay proper compensation.
Insurance company won't authorize treatment?
It is common for insurance companies to ignore or deny a doctor's request for authorization to provide patients with treatment, medication or diagnostic studies. If this happens to you then you need to be able to file in Court to get a judge to Order the insurance company to provide the treatment.
See our page titled Work Comp Laws regarding the utilization review process and how to appeal to the Independent Medical Review when the insurance company denies treatment etc.
Employer requires you to use sick time to rest after an injury?
You must be provided with time off work if you are hurt and cannot work. Your employer cannot make you use your sick or vacation time to recover from a work injury. We will make sure you get proper time off to recover from work injuries.

What Is Work Comp?
Worker compensation is a system designed to deliver benefits to injured workers. You do not have to prove that someone was negligent and caused injury, rather you just have to show that you were injured at work. If so, you will have the right to medical treatment and money to replace wages and compensate for damage to your body.
Workers compensation is not suing your employer. Your employer should have insurance and the insurance company is required to provide work comp benefits for injured workers. This includes medical treatment, and money, when an employee is injured at work. You should not pay a deductible every time you see a doctor, nor should you be required to pay for prescription medication for an injury sustained while you were working.
Your employer's work comp insurance covers all your costs.
An injured worker will receive the necessary therapy to recover and to return to work. Money is paid to an injured worker as Temporary Disability Benefits during the time the worker is unable to work. Even after returning to work, there is more money for the injured worker as Permanent Disability Benefits.

All On-The-Job Accidents and Injuries are covered.
Even if you are injured due to your own fault --- you are still covered! Beach Cities Legal Center will fight for your rights, and get you paid the most money. It doesn't matter if you were negligent while working. You still have the right to benefits. Many people have injuries from working repetitive jobs. You have the right to work comp benefits for work injuries even if you cannot point to a specific event that caused the injury.
What Does a Work Comp Lawyer Cost?
Workers Compensation Lawyers take 15% of a total settlement. It is important to have a Certified Workers Compensation Lawyer to maximize your award and the difference between having a knowledgeable, experienced lawyer makes up for the small percentage taken.
